How to Organize Halloween Decorations
Gather all decorations. Gather all decorations from various rooms, cabinets, areas, etc. and put it all in one place.
Purge. Donate, recycle or trash decorations you no longer like, use or want.
Contain. Contain the decorations in very specific bins. Orange bins or lids like these are popular for storing Halloween decorations or weathertight bins. Use silica gel packets to keep moisture minimal and to help preserve some of your items, especially fabric decorations.
Wrap. Wrap breakable items in bubble wrap or tissue paper.
Make a list. Make a list of everything you may want to buy or need to replace for the following year.
Inventory. Inventory what is in each box, so you can find exactly what you are looking for.
Label. Label each box. I like using these labels.
Store. Store in a place where you have room. This could be in a closet, attic, basement, etc.
